Choosing the Right Material
I found that the material of the sign greatly affects its visibility and durability. I had the option of using paper, vinyl, or even coroplast. Each material has its advantages; for example, vinyl is weather-resistant, while paper is cost-effective for short-term use. I considered where my sign would be displayed and the duration of my sale before making a choice.

Color and Design Considerations
I learned that color choices can significantly impact the effectiveness of my sign. Bold colors like red and yellow immediately grab attention. I opted for a simple design with large, clear fonts to ensure that my message was easy to read. A cluttered design can confuse potential customers, so I kept it straightforward.

Local Regulations and Permits
Before displaying my sign, I checked local regulations regarding signage. I wanted to ensure compliance to avoid any potential fines. In some areas, permits may be required for outdoor signs, so I took the time to research and secure any necessary approvals.
